Celebrate 50 years of Pink Floyd's famous The Dark Side of the Moon album in this incredible and immersive experience in Tūhura Otago Museum’s 360-degree Planetarium. It's your last chance to see this phenomenal show with breathtaking visuals and spectacular surround sound, bringing to life this legendary album.
Dark Side of the Moon, originally released in March 1973, celebrates its 50th anniversary, and what more fitting a place to experience it than in a planetarium. Fly through the solar system with a mixture of psychedelic art, space and incredible music. We're sure you'll be wowed by The Great Gig in the Sky, sit back in the reclined seating of the planetarium and enjoy the immersive experience of the domed-screen theatre.
Enjoy this wild ride with a Standard Session (film only) or a Premium Session (film + drink + Precinct platter)
Runtime 44 mins, please arrive 15 minutes before the scheduled show time.
